Liverpool FC is reportedly considering Sunderland’s 23-year-old goalkeeper, Anthony Patterson, as a potential long-term replacement for Caoimhin Kelleher.
Kelleher’s outstanding performances have drawn attention from clubs such as Celtic and various Premier League teams, leading Liverpool to prepare for the future.
With 27 Championship appearances and 8 clean sheets this season, Patterson emerges as a strong candidate for the position.
